Commit 0af6a951 authored by 段英荣's avatar 段英荣

modify bug

parent badb8ad5
...@@ -103,16 +103,17 @@ def get_home_recommend_topic_ids(user_id,device_id,offset,size,query=None,query_ ...@@ -103,16 +103,17 @@ def get_home_recommend_topic_ids(user_id,device_id,offset,size,query=None,query_
if len(recommend_topic_ids) >= size: if len(recommend_topic_ids) >= size:
break break
offi_unread_topic_id_dict = dict()
if len(recommend_topic_ids) < size and len(unread_topic_id_dict)>0: if len(recommend_topic_ids) < size and len(unread_topic_id_dict)>0:
recommend_len = len(recommend_topic_ids)
for unread_topic_id in unread_topic_id_dict: for unread_topic_id in unread_topic_id_dict:
if len(recommend_topic_ids)<size: if len(recommend_topic_ids)<size:
recommend_topic_ids.append(unread_topic_id) recommend_topic_ids.append(unread_topic_id)
unread_topic_id_dict.pop(unread_topic_id) else:
offi_unread_topic_id_dict[unread_topic_id] = unread_topic_id_dict[unread_topic_id]
redis_dict = { redis_dict = {
"unread_topic_id":json.dumps(unread_topic_id_dict), "unread_topic_id":json.dumps(offi_unread_topic_id_dict),
"last_offset_num":offset+size, "last_offset_num":offset+size,
offset: json.dumps(recommend_topic_ids) offset: json.dumps(recommend_topic_ids)
} }
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ment